China Travel Guide: Exploring the Silk Road Gem - Lanzhou373
Introduction
Lanzhou, the capital city of Gansu Province, is a captivating destination steeped in history, culture, and natural beauty. As a gateway to the Silk Road, Lanzhou holds significant importance and offers a plethora of attractions to enchant travelers seeking adventure and cultural immersion.Day 1: A Historical Odyssey
Begin your Lanzhou exploration at the Gansu Provincial Museum, home to a vast collection of artifacts that narrate the rich history of the region. Next, embark on a pilgrimage to the White Pagoda Temple, a Buddhist landmark adorned with intricate architecture and stunning views of the city skyline.Day 2: Culinary Delights and Natural Wonders
Indulge in Lanzhou's culinary scene by savoring the renowned Lanzhou Beef Noodle Soup. Take a leisurely stroll along the Yellow River, China's second-longest river, and marvel at its sheer magnitude. In the evening, witness the vibrant ambiance of the Yellow River Night Market.Day 3: Oasis of Tranquility
Escape the urban hustle and bustle with a delightful excursion to the Bingling Temple Grottoes. Nestled amidst towering cliffs, these Buddhist caves house exquisite murals and sculptures that showcase the artistic prowess of ancient craftsmen.Day 4: Exploring the Silk Road
Embark on a day trip to Zhangye, a historic Silk Road town. Immerse yourself in the vibrant street markets and admire the iconic Danxia Landforms, a mesmerizing geological spectacle.Accommodation
Lanzhou offers a wide range of accommodation options to cater to every budget and preference. Consider the luxurious Lanzhou JW Marriott Hotel, the comfortable DoubleTree by Hilton Lanzhou, or the budget-friendly 7 Days Inn Lanzhou Lanzhou Railway Station.Food and Drink
Lanzhou is renowned for its tantalizing cuisine. Must-try dishes include Lanzhou Beef Noodle Soup, Lanzhou Lamei (pulled noodles), and Bingliang (cold noodles). For dining options, try the Muslim Street Beef Noodle Restaurant, known for its authentic Lanzhou Beef Noodle Soup, or the Zhangzhengdao Chuoqu Restaurant, which serves a variety of Gansu specialties.Getting There and Around
Lanzhou Zhongchuan International Airport connects the city to major destinations worldwide. Within Lanzhou, public transportation is readily available, including buses, subways, and taxis.Tips for Travelers
